i make problem on SP1223N.
before make problem, SP1223N has unaccessable sectors with clicking noise.
i tried hdd img copy, 30% copied with some bad sectors.
but after 30%...all sectors are bad with clicking noise.

i tried "A-List clear"...use PC3K
but same result.
then tried "Transfer A-List to S-List".

after "Transfer A-List to S-List", accessable almost of sectors.
but... it make problem.

sectors are repeat.
like this
1122334455=>1122334455=>1122334455=>1122334455

how can i fix it?

I hope, you saved modules before manipulations wiht defects lists.
In fact Slip List is a translator. So, you should restore old S-List.
You can also check integrity of the S- and T-Lists and module CONFIG2.
